2 bed apartment for sale in Archer Place, Bishop's Stortford, Hertfordshire
Asking Price £290,000
2 bedrooms
1 bathroom
1 reception
559.72 sq ft (52 sq m)
2 bedrooms
1 bathroom
1 reception
559.72 sq ft (52 sq m)